Job Description:

We are seeking a Principal Field Service Engineer with a strong background in customer service and advanced technical maintenance to join our Boulder-based Service Team supporting our Quantum Cryogenic product line.

This role serves as a technical expert and escalation point, working cross-functionally with Engineering, Manufacturing, Quality, and Supply Chain to deliver high-quality, timely service solutions and drive continuous product and process improvements.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Perform preventative and corrective maintenance on cryogenic systems at customer sites.
  • Lead installation and commissioning activities, including final system acceptance in accordance with defined protocols.
  • Diagnose, troubleshoot, and repair complex equipment issues via on-site visits, telephone, and email support.
  • Serve as a technical escalation point, managing and resolving advanced customer and system issues.
  • Communicate clearly and professionally with customers to ensure an exceptional service experience.
  • Complete work orders, service reports, and documentation accurately and within established timelines.
  • Develop, maintain, and continuously improve service procedures, protocols, and technical documentation.
  • Partner cross-functionally with Engineering, Operations, Quality, and Supply Chain to support product improvements and reliability initiatives.
  • Deliver technical training and instruction to customers, field engineers, and internal teams.
  • Participate in ongoing training and certification programs to maintain and expand technical expertise.
  • Provide input into service strategy, tools, and processes to enhance operational efficiency and customer satisfaction.

About FormFactor

FormFactor, Inc. is a leading provider of essential test and measurement technologies along the full IC life cycle ? from characterization, modeling, reliability, and design de-bug, to qualification and production test. Semiconductor companies rely upon FormFactor?s products and services to accelerate profitability by optimizing device performance and advancing yield knowledge. The Company serves customers through its network of facilities in Asia, Europe, and North America. FormFactor is headquartered in Livermore, California with operations worldwide.
